Product overview
This IHC kit is used to detect mouse and rabbit primary antibodies in immunohistochemistry (IHC). It uses an HRP micro-polymer secondary antibody for highly sensitive detection.
HRP micro-polymer methods are more sensitive than the traditional streptavidin-biotin method, and they do not require a blocking step for endogenous biotin.
This kit is an exact copy of EXPOSE Mouse and Rabbit Specific HRP/DAB Detection IHC Kit ab80436, except that it uses the HRP micro-polymer antibody used during the validation of Abcam's antibodies in IHC. This HRP micro-polymer antibody was identified by our R&D team as giving the most sensitive and specific staining.
The kit includes ready-to-use hydrogen peroxide blocking reagent, protein blocking reagent, HRP micro-polymer conjugated goat anti-rabbit secondary antibody, and DAB chromogen/substrate. It includes an unconjugated rabbit anti-mouse antibody, which is used together with the HRP polymer anti-rabbit antibody to detect mouse primary antibodies.

ab1220 staining human kidney sections by IHC-P using EXPOSE IHC detection kit ab80436 (this kit is identical to ab80436, except that it uses the same HRP polymer secondary antibody used by Abcam's R&D team for antibody validation). Formalin fixed paraffin embedded tissue sections were pre-treated using heat mediated antigen retrieval (using a pressure cooker) with sodium citrate buffer (pH 6) for 30 minutes. The section was incubated with ab1220, 5 µg/ml, for 1 hour at room temperature. DAB was used as the chromogen and the section was counterstained with haematoxylin and mounted with DPX.
